The Milwaukee Panthers embody a celebrated basketball legacy, the authentic grit of their home, and the proud spirit of being Milwaukee's public university. The university's name became synonymous with "Cinderella" during a magical mid-2000s run, when coach Bruce Pearl's high-energy teams captivated the nation, culminating in a 2005 trip to the NCAA Tournament's Sweet Sixteen after upsetting Alabama and Boston College. Proving their giant-killer status, the Panthers returned to the tournament the following year and secured another thrilling upset victory over Oklahoma, cementing their place in March Madness history. This tradition of postseason success is also deeply rooted in the men's soccer program, a perennial Horizon League power that has made numerous NCAA Tournament appearances, including its own run to the Sweet Sixteen. As a long-standing power in the Horizon League, the Panthers proudly play their home games at the downtown UW-Milwaukee Panther Arena, drawing on the energy and passion of their city. The Milwaukee Panthers represent the heart of their city, a program with a proven history of reaching the national stage and embodying the tough, determined spirit of a champion.
